privatevoidCleanForm(){foreach(varcinthis.Controls){if(cisTextBox){((TextBox)c).Text=String.Empty;}}}上述方法无效,控件未被清除。它编译正常,但什么也不做。有什么想法吗? 最佳答案 我喜欢lambda:)privatevoidClearTextBoxes(){Actionfunc=null;func=(controls)=>{foreach(Controlcontrolincontrols)if(controlisTextBox)(c
我想在WPFTextBox中显示一个选择,即使它没有获得焦点。我该怎么做? 最佳答案 我已将此解决方案用于RichTextBox,但我认为它也适用于标准文本框。基本上,您需要处理LostFocus事件并将其标记为已处理。protectedvoidMyTextBox_LostFocus(objectsender,RoutedEventArgse){//WhentheRichTextBoxlosesfocustheusercannolongerseetheselection.//ThisisahacktomaketheRichTextB
我在Ubuntu上使用jq,但现在我必须将我的命令移植到Windows8.1。我正在使用jq1.6。但我在Windowsjq上使用strptime时遇到此错误。jq:error(atxxxx.json:xxx):strptime/1notimplementedonthisplatform适用于Windows的strptime还有哪些其他选项?示例:这对我来说适用于Ubuntu,并且需要使其适用于Windows(只需要以秒为单位的时差)。jq-n'{"t1":"2018-06-0112:45:56","t2":"2018-06-0322:10:01"}|(.t2|strptime("%Y
我希望解析内部JSON对象的各个元素以在数据库中构建/加载。以下是JSON对象。如何解析id、namequeue等元素?我将循环迭代它并构建插入查询。{"apps":{"app":[{"id":"application_1540378900448_18838","user":"hive","name":"insertoverwritetabl...summary_view_stg_etl(Stage-2)","queue":"Data_Ingestion","state":"FINISHED","finalStatus":"SUCCEEDED","progress":100},{"id
我一直在享受JQ(Doc)提供的强大过滤器。Twitter的公共(public)API提供格式良好的json文件。我可以访问其中的大量内容,并且可以访问Hadoop集群。在那里,我决定不使用Elephantbird将它们加载到Pig中,而是在mapperstreaming中尝试JQ看看它是否更快。这是我的最终查询:nohuphadoopjar$HADOOP_HOME/share/hadoop/tools/lib/hadoop-streaming-2.5.1.jar\-files$HOME/bin/jq\-Dmapreduce.map.memory.mb=2048\-Dmapred.ou
在C#的多线程访问中,在线程间的相互访问时因为线程安全问题有访问限制,在创建一般线程时,对于界面元素访问时这样的问题比较常见。 比如,创建一个form1,上面放置一个textbox控件,创建一个线程去访问textbox,界面如下: 按钮buuton1的代码:privatevoidbutton1_Click(objectsender,EventArgse){varthread1=newSystem.Threading.Thread(Func1);thread1.Start();} 就是简单地创建一个线程,线程里面运行的func1代码:privatevoidFunc1(){for(int
我的问题是:我想获取textbox1的值,然后将其传输到另一个页面,其中textbox1的值将出现在textbox2中。下面是我的PHP代码:Name:我还添加了下面的代码,错误是“Notice:Undefinedindex:name”或 最佳答案 在testing2.php中使用以下代码获取名称:if(!empty($_POST['name'])){$name=$_POST['name']);}当您创建下一个页面时,使用$name的值来预填充表单字段:Name:">但是,在这样做之前,一定要使用正则表达式来验证$name只包含有效
这是我第一个使用jquerymobile的网站,我在使用外部链接时遇到了问题。我会给你看一个例子。这是A页PageAPageAPageB当我点击链接时,我将转到页面B(到目前为止,一切正常)PagBPageBIamPageB!!!Test当我在页面B时,我按下Android移动设备中的硬件后退按钮并返回到页面A。然后我再次按下页面A中的链接。页面B出现,但它也加载页面A并显示典型的加载div..问题是?为什么会这样??其次,这样做的方法是什么?我找到了一种方法来解决页面B中的pagebeforehide事件,但我认为这不是解决问题的方法..谢谢! 最佳答案
我为TextView背景创建了一个形状我的TextView是:当文本像这样短时但是当文本太大时不显示背景和eclipselogcat显示Shaperoundrecttoolargetoberenderedintoatexture(424x5884,max=2048x2048)如何解决?谢谢 最佳答案 编辑:最简单的解决方案是去除圆角。如果移除圆角并使用简单的矩形,硬件渲染器将不再为背景层创建单个大纹理,也不会再遇到纹理大小限制。一个简单的解决方法应该是恢复该View的软件渲染:Viewview=findViewById(R.id.t
我需要一个精简的TextBox解决方案。RichTextBox被证明太慢了,所以我想采用所有者绘图或自定义控件构建的方式。我需要一个可以处理大文本内容并通过在单词或单个字符周围绘制彩色背景来提供简单突出显示的文本框。重要的是,文本字符串本身不包含标记,而是单独存储要标记的单词的索引。相对于文本字符串开头的索引(在谈论.NETTextBox时也称为Text属性)。我认为它必须涉及在我自己的控制下绘制文本,因为Windows编辑控件将无法执行我需要的操作。我的应用程序是Windows窗体。制作这样的控件的正确方法是什么,有没有例子?能否在.NET下进行快速控制?(已经假设需要本地API调用